Memo to the incoming director — Loyalty programme overhaul. Welcome aboard. First item on your plate: our Kestrel Club scheme is getting a full rework. Short version — generous earn rates, weak redemption partners, and margins taking the hit. The team has a tiered replacement drafted, with Marlow's group handling member migration and Pettifer's on partner renegotiation. Launch is pencilled for next quarter, pending your sign-off. The sensitive commercial background is set out below.

confidential, yahip-hagug: Gorixax Logistics plans to lower the Ulaael list price by 26.6 percent in October. The pricing group signed off on a budget of $199.9 million for Project Holix. The renewal with Kasdorox Systems closes at $137.5 million a year, 8.2 percent above the last contract. Project Lamion slips by a full year because of the audit delay.

Subject: DR drill tonight — Restocko planner

Team,

DR drill for the Restocko vending restock planner starts 22:00. We'll kill the primary region and fail over to the Bexley Hollow site. Expect the route optimizer to lag ~5 min while inventory snapshots replay. Do not restock machines manually during the window; the planner reconciles after cutover. If the failover console rejects your session, that's expected — auth resets with the region. Recover access with the phrase below.

unlock words, yawig-kagef: gordor-holvan-ulaael-pramir-ulaiel-tamdor

Q3 Planning Note — Finance Team

Vellum Analytics proposes launching a mid-market subscription tier, "Vellum Plus," in early Q3. Modelling by Priya Orlens suggests uptake of 8–11% among existing Starter customers, with incremental ARR of roughly 1.4M by year-end. Billing changes require two sprint cycles; provisioning costs remain within the approved envelope. Please validate margin assumptions before the 14th. The strategic rationale is summarised in the confidential note below.

internal memo for kawip-hadug: Headcount on the Wenwyn team goes from 7 to 140 by the end of January. Gross margin on Wenwyn came in at 20 percent against a plan of 15 percent.